The 2026 National Duals field was announced on May 12 — Iowa State will compete in the event, Iowa will not.
The Tulsa, Oklahoma, event will include the Cyclones as well as Oklahoma State, NC State, North Carolina, Wyoming, Virginia Tech, Arizona State, Rutgers, Minnesota, Ohio State, Arkansas-Little Rock, Oklahoma, Missouri, Stanford, Pittsburgh and Maryland.
The National Duals, scheduled for Dec. 12-13 at BOK Center, carries a total purse of more than $1.2 million.
Iowa finished second at last year’s revamped National Duals, earning $150,000. Champion Ohio State took home $200,000. Iowa State did not get an invite to the 2025 Duals.
Other top programs opting to skip this year’s National Duals include Penn State and Nebraska. Penn State coach Cael Sanderson told On3 that his program is “just not really interested.” The Nittany Lions did not participate in last year’s event, either.
